В чем суть метода последовательной детализации кратко

Обновлено: 02.07.2024

Информатика определяет структурное программирование как совокупность общих правил в проектировании, разработке, оформлении программных продуктов. Его задача – облегчить создание, тестирование, повысить производительность, улучшить работу программ. Последовательный алгоритм совместно с пошаговой детализацией делают структуру продуктов проще, легче для восприятия. Подход позволяет отказаться от беспорядочных алгоритмов.

Задача решается четко, понятно. Исполнитель структурирует свои действия, определяет количество операций. Это оптимальный вариант для создания масштабной программной системы. Исполнитель или команда специалистов ставит перед собой пять основных задач:

  • Проведение тщательного анализа исходного задания;
  • Формирование подзадач;
  • Построение иерархии из полученных подзадач;
  • Составление последовательности действий для решения основного задания: предписание, алгоритм;
  • Составление вспомогательных блок-схем, постепенное углубление в задачу.

Что такое пошаговая детализация – метод пошаговой детализации

Пошаговой детализацией называют простую процедуру. Модульная логика выражается в первоначальной форме через условные, гипотетические термины на языке сложного уровня. В процессе построения блок-схемы происходит последующая детализация каждой задачи. Используется менее сложный конструктив. Процесс повторяется до момента достижения понятного, доступного программного языка.

Исполнитель может выходить на минимизацию деталей. Машинный язык относят к простейшим формам изъяснения, тогда как человеческая речь находится на высоком уровне. Методика позволяет:

  • Использовать основной конструктив, применяемый в структурном программировании;
  • Упорядочивать класс сложных рассуждений в простую систему;
  • Приводить задание к группе элементарных задач.

Какая связь между методом последовательного построения алгоритма и пошаговой детализацией

Алгоритм – понятная, точная задача для исполнителя. Решая ее, он действует последовательно, поэтапно достигая основной цели. Особенности алгоритмов:

  • Единственное толкование – понятная структура;
  • Результативность решения каждого задания;
  • Возможность использовать конструкцию для приведения разнообразных заданий к единому решению;
  • Окончание каждой задачи перед переходом к следующему заданию.

Запись алгоритма может осуществляться с помощью языков программирования, учебных алгоритмических конструктивов, блок-схем, естественного языка. Различают три основных вида структур:

  1. Конструкции с разветвлениями. Состоит из одного логического условия. Возможно наличие нескольких веток для обработки полученных данных. Исполнитель может выбрать оптимальный вариант на основе исходной информации.
  2. Циклические структуры. Формируются за счет повторения определенных действий.
  3. Последовательное построение. Предполагает строгий порядок выполнения операций.

Последовательный тип часто предполагает движение вниз от основного блока. Метод последовательной детализации позволяет разработать следующую структуру:

Свидетельство и скидка на обучение каждому участнику

Зарегистрироваться 15–17 марта 2022 г.

Метод последовательной детализации

Описание презентации по отдельным слайдам:

Метод последовательной детализации

Метод последовательной детализации

Метод последовательной детализации это один из основных методов структурного.

Метод последовательной детализации это один из основных методов структурного программирования, заключающийся в разработке сложных алгоритмов путем построения иерархии подзадач

Суть метода 1) Анализируется задача, в ней выделяются подзадачи, строится иер.

Суть метода 1) Анализируется задача, в ней выделяются подзадачи, строится иерархия таких подзадач 2) Составляются алгоритмы, начиная с основного алгоритма, далее вспомогательные с последовательным углублением уровня Задача Подзадача1 Подзадача2 Подзадача1.1 Подзадача2.1 Подзадача2.2

Задача Вычислить площадь N-угольника, заданного координатами своих вершин. x1.

Задача Вычислить площадь N-угольника, заданного координатами своих вершин. x1,y1 x2,y2 x3,y3 x4,y4 x5,y5 x6,y6

I этап Площадь N-угольника S=S1+S2+…Sn-2 x1,y1 x2,y2 x3,y3 x4,y4 x5,y5 x6,y6.

I этап Площадь N-угольника S=S1+S2+…Sn-2 x1,y1 x2,y2 x3,y3 x4,y4 x5,y5 x6,y6 1) Разбиение n-угольника диагональным линиями на треугольники

II этап Площадь треугольника x1,y1 x2,y2 x3,y3 x4,y4 x5,y5 x6,y6 1) Нахождени.

II этап Площадь треугольника x1,y1 x2,y2 x3,y3 x4,y4 x5,y5 x6,y6 1) Нахождение площади треугольников по формуле Герона

III этап Длина стороны треугольника x1,y1 x2,y2 x3,y3 x4,y4 x5,y5 x6,y6 1) На.

III этап Длина стороны треугольника x1,y1 x2,y2 x3,y3 x4,y4 x5,y5 x6,y6 1) Нахождение длин сторон треугольника по заданным координатам точек

Метод последовательной детализации в решении задачи Вычисление площади многоу.

Метод последовательной детализации в решении задачи Вычисление площади многоугольника Вычисление площади треугольника Вычисление длины отрезка

  • подготовка к ЕГЭ/ОГЭ и ВПР
  • по всем предметам 1-11 классов

Курс повышения квалификации

Дистанционное обучение как современный формат преподавания


Курс повышения квалификации

Инструменты онлайн-обучения на примере программ Zoom, Skype, Microsoft Teams, Bandicam

  • Курс добавлен 31.01.2022
  • Сейчас обучается 35 человек из 22 регионов

Курс повышения квалификации

Педагогическая деятельность в контексте профессионального стандарта педагога и ФГОС

  • Для учеников 1-11 классов и дошкольников
  • Бесплатные сертификаты учителям и участникам

Дистанционные курсы для педагогов

Найдите материал к любому уроку, указав свой предмет (категорию), класс, учебник и тему:

5 613 323 материала в базе

Материал подходит для УМК

2.2.11. Метод последовательной детализации

  • ЗП до 91 000 руб.
  • Гибкий график
  • Удаленная работа

Самые массовые международные дистанционные

Школьные Инфоконкурсы 2022

Свидетельство и скидка на обучение каждому участнику

Другие материалы

Вам будут интересны эти курсы:

Оставьте свой комментарий

  • 29.11.2019 825
  • PPTX 97.5 кбайт
  • 23 скачивания
  • Оцените материал:

Настоящий материал опубликован пользователем Васильченко Екатерина Александровна. Инфоурок является информационным посредником и предоставляет пользователям возможность размещать на сайте методические материалы. Всю ответственность за опубликованные материалы, содержащиеся в них сведения, а также за соблюдение авторских прав несут пользователи, загрузившие материал на сайт

Если Вы считаете, что материал нарушает авторские права либо по каким-то другим причинам должен быть удален с сайта, Вы можете оставить жалобу на материал.

Автор материала

40%

  • Подготовка к ЕГЭ/ОГЭ и ВПР
  • Для учеников 1-11 классов

Московский институт профессиональной
переподготовки и повышения
квалификации педагогов

Дистанционные курсы
для педагогов

663 курса от 690 рублей

Выбрать курс со скидкой

Выдаём документы
установленного образца!

Учителя о ЕГЭ: секреты успешной подготовки

Время чтения: 11 минут

Россияне ценят в учителях образованность, любовь и доброжелательность к детям

Время чтения: 2 минуты

В Россию приехали 10 тысяч детей из Луганской и Донецкой Народных республик

Время чтения: 2 минуты

Рособрнадзор предложил дать возможность детям из ДНР и ЛНР поступать в вузы без сдачи ЕГЭ

Время чтения: 1 минута

Отчисленные за рубежом студенты смогут бесплатно учиться в России

Время чтения: 1 минута

Онлайн-тренинг: нейрогимнастика для успешной учёбы и комфортной жизни

Время чтения: 2 минуты

Новые курсы: преподавание блогинга и архитектуры, подготовка аспирантов и другие

Время чтения: 16 минут

Подарочные сертификаты

Ответственность за разрешение любых спорных моментов, касающихся самих материалов и их содержания, берут на себя пользователи, разместившие материал на сайте. Однако администрация сайта готова оказать всяческую поддержку в решении любых вопросов, связанных с работой и содержанием сайта. Если Вы заметили, что на данном сайте незаконно используются материалы, сообщите об этом администрации сайта через форму обратной связи.

Все материалы, размещенные на сайте, созданы авторами сайта либо размещены пользователями сайта и представлены на сайте исключительно для ознакомления. Авторские права на материалы принадлежат их законным авторам. Частичное или полное копирование материалов сайта без письменного разрешения администрации сайта запрещено! Мнение администрации может не совпадать с точкой зрения авторов.

Нажмите, чтобы узнать подробности

В разработке презентации пошагово описан один из методов структурного программирования.

Метод последовательной детализации.

Информатика 11 класс

Учитель: Литвинович В.П.

 Метод последовательной детализации является одним из основных методов структурного программирования. Суть этого метода заключается в разработке сложных алгоритмов путем построения иерархии подзадач.

Метод последовательной детализации является одним из основных методов структурного программирования.

Суть этого метода заключается в разработке сложных алгоритмов путем построения иерархии

Суть метода : Анализируется исходная задача. Выделяются подзадачи. Строится иерархия подзадач Составляется алгоритм (программа) основной задачи Составляется вспомогательный алгоритм (подпрограммы) с последовательным углублением уровня.

Суть метода :

  • Анализируется исходная задача.
  • Выделяются подзадачи.
  • Строится иерархия подзадач
  • Составляется алгоритм (программа) основной задачи
  • Составляется вспомогательный алгоритм (подпрограммы) с последовательным углублением уровня.

Иерархия подзадач

 Пример 1 Вычислить площадь выпуклого N- угольника, заданного координатами своих вершин. Найти площадь выпуклого многоугольника: Площадь многоугольника определяется , как сумма площадей N-2 треугольников. S- треугольника определяется: по формуле Герона S =√(p(p-a)(p-b)(p-c)

Пример 1 Вычислить площадь выпуклого N- угольника, заданного координатами своих вершин.

Найти площадь выпуклого многоугольника:

Площадь многоугольника

определяется , как сумма

площадей N-2 треугольников.

S- треугольника определяется:

по формуле Герона

 Первый шаг детализации Стороны треугольника определяются по теореме Пифагора: Исходные данные, координаты вершин треугольника можно задать с помощью массива: Организация данных

Первый шаг детализации Стороны треугольника определяются по теореме Пифагора: Исходные данные, координаты вершин треугольника можно задать с помощью массива:

Организация данных

 Второй шаг детализации: Запрограммируем процедуру Treugolnik. В разделе подпрограмм этой процедуры запишем лишь интерфейс подпрограммы Line, создав функцию.

Второй шаг детализации: Запрограммируем процедуру Treugolnik. В разделе подпрограмм этой процедуры запишем лишь интерфейс подпрограммы Line, создав функцию.

Третий шаг детализации Запрограммируем функцию Line. Координаты концов отрезка задаем параметрами: x a, Y a –первая точка, x b, У b – вторая. Собираем все проделанные шаги и составляем программу: ………………………………………………………………………………………… ..

Третий шаг детализации Запрограммируем функцию Line. Координаты концов отрезка задаем параметрами: x a, Y a –первая точка, x b, У b – вторая.

Собираем все проделанные шаги и составляем программу:

.

Применение метода последовательной детализации Над большим программным проектом работает несколько специалистов. Руководитель группы проектирует многоуровневую структуру алгоритма и составляет основную программу, а написание подпрограмм поручает другим программистам. Программистам необходимо договорится об интерфейсе подпрограмм: именах, параметрах. Внутренне устройство подпрограммы работа программиста Большие проекты подпрограмм объединяются в МОДУЛИ.

Применение метода последовательной детализации

  • Над большим программным проектом работает несколько специалистов.
  • Руководитель группы проектирует многоуровневую структуру алгоритма и составляет основную программу, а написание подпрограмм поручает другим программистам.
  • Программистам необходимо договорится об интерфейсе подпрограмм: именах, параметрах.
  • Внутренне устройство подпрограммы работа программиста
  • Большие проекты подпрограмм объединяются в МОДУЛИ.

Домашнее задание. § 2.2.11 чит. Запомнить …

Практическая работа № 6. Проверить работу программы N ugolnik Задать N = 4 Вычислить площадь квадрата с длинами сторон равными 2 и координатами вершин: Получить результат.

Практическая работа № 6. Проверить работу программы N ugolnik

Вычислить площадь квадрата с длинами сторон равными 2 и координатами вершин:

Вопрос по информатике:

В чем суть метода последовательной детализации

Трудности с пониманием предмета? Готовишься к экзаменам, ОГЭ или ЕГЭ?

Воспользуйся формой подбора репетитора и занимайся онлайн. Пробный урок - бесплатно!

  • 09.01.2017 20:08
  • Информатика
  • remove_red_eye 17659
  • thumb_up 12
Ответы и объяснения 1

Сначала анализируется исходная задача. В ней выделяются подзадачи. Строится иерархия таких подзадач.Затем составляются алгоритмы (или программы), начиная с основного алгоритма (основной программы), далее — вспомогательные алгоритмы (подпрограммы) с последовательным углублением уровня, пока не получим алгоритмы, состоящие из простых команд.

Знаете ответ? Поделитесь им!

Как написать хороший ответ?

Чтобы добавить хороший ответ необходимо:

  • Отвечать достоверно на те вопросы, на которые знаете правильный ответ;
  • Писать подробно, чтобы ответ был исчерпывающий и не побуждал на дополнительные вопросы к нему;
  • Писать без грамматических, орфографических и пунктуационных ошибок.

Этого делать не стоит:

Есть сомнения?

Не нашли подходящего ответа на вопрос или ответ отсутствует? Воспользуйтесь поиском по сайту, чтобы найти все ответы на похожие вопросы в разделе Информатика.

Трудности с домашними заданиями? Не стесняйтесь попросить о помощи - смело задавайте вопросы!

Информатика — наука о методах и процессах сбора, хранения, обработки, передачи, анализа и оценки информации с применением компьютерных технологий, обеспечивающих возможность её использования для принятия решений.

Нажмите, чтобы узнать подробности

В разработке презентации пошагово описан один из методов структурного программирования.

Метод последовательной детализации.

Информатика 11 класс

Учитель: Литвинович В.П.

 Метод последовательной детализации является одним из основных методов структурного программирования. Суть этого метода заключается в разработке сложных алгоритмов путем построения иерархии подзадач.

Метод последовательной детализации является одним из основных методов структурного программирования.

Суть этого метода заключается в разработке сложных алгоритмов путем построения иерархии

Суть метода : Анализируется исходная задача. Выделяются подзадачи. Строится иерархия подзадач Составляется алгоритм (программа) основной задачи Составляется вспомогательный алгоритм (подпрограммы) с последовательным углублением уровня.

Суть метода :

  • Анализируется исходная задача.
  • Выделяются подзадачи.
  • Строится иерархия подзадач
  • Составляется алгоритм (программа) основной задачи
  • Составляется вспомогательный алгоритм (подпрограммы) с последовательным углублением уровня.

Иерархия подзадач

 Пример 1 Вычислить площадь выпуклого N- угольника, заданного координатами своих вершин. Найти площадь выпуклого многоугольника: Площадь многоугольника определяется , как сумма площадей N-2 треугольников. S- треугольника определяется: по формуле Герона S =√(p(p-a)(p-b)(p-c)

Пример 1 Вычислить площадь выпуклого N- угольника, заданного координатами своих вершин.

Найти площадь выпуклого многоугольника:

Площадь многоугольника

определяется , как сумма

площадей N-2 треугольников.

S- треугольника определяется:

по формуле Герона

 Первый шаг детализации Стороны треугольника определяются по теореме Пифагора: Исходные данные, координаты вершин треугольника можно задать с помощью массива: Организация данных

Первый шаг детализации Стороны треугольника определяются по теореме Пифагора: Исходные данные, координаты вершин треугольника можно задать с помощью массива:

Организация данных

 Второй шаг детализации: Запрограммируем процедуру Treugolnik. В разделе подпрограмм этой процедуры запишем лишь интерфейс подпрограммы Line, создав функцию.

Второй шаг детализации: Запрограммируем процедуру Treugolnik. В разделе подпрограмм этой процедуры запишем лишь интерфейс подпрограммы Line, создав функцию.

Третий шаг детализации Запрограммируем функцию Line. Координаты концов отрезка задаем параметрами: x a, Y a –первая точка, x b, У b – вторая. Собираем все проделанные шаги и составляем программу: ………………………………………………………………………………………… ..

Третий шаг детализации Запрограммируем функцию Line. Координаты концов отрезка задаем параметрами: x a, Y a –первая точка, x b, У b – вторая.

Собираем все проделанные шаги и составляем программу:

.

Применение метода последовательной детализации Над большим программным проектом работает несколько специалистов. Руководитель группы проектирует многоуровневую структуру алгоритма и составляет основную программу, а написание подпрограмм поручает другим программистам. Программистам необходимо договорится об интерфейсе подпрограмм: именах, параметрах. Внутренне устройство подпрограммы работа программиста Большие проекты подпрограмм объединяются в МОДУЛИ.

Применение метода последовательной детализации

  • Над большим программным проектом работает несколько специалистов.
  • Руководитель группы проектирует многоуровневую структуру алгоритма и составляет основную программу, а написание подпрограмм поручает другим программистам.
  • Программистам необходимо договорится об интерфейсе подпрограмм: именах, параметрах.
  • Внутренне устройство подпрограммы работа программиста
  • Большие проекты подпрограмм объединяются в МОДУЛИ.

Домашнее задание. § 2.2.11 чит. Запомнить …

Практическая работа № 6. Проверить работу программы N ugolnik Задать N = 4 Вычислить площадь квадрата с длинами сторон равными 2 и координатами вершин: Получить результат.

Практическая работа № 6. Проверить работу программы N ugolnik

Вычислить площадь квадрата с длинами сторон равными 2 и координатами вершин:

Читайте также: